Bihar is the state with the third largest number of snakebite deaths per year in India. This prospective, one-year study of 608 snakebites provides the first data from Bihar on determinants of unfavourable outcomes in snakebites. Any delay in reaching hospital raised the risk of a snakebite patient for an unfavourable outcome [OR 8.88, CI 2.04-38.8]. Attending a traditional practitioner prior t...
Snakebites envenomation is an important public health problem in many tropical and subtropical countries and the most affected being farmers, pastoralists, hunters and children. Most of the snakebite morbidity and mortality remain undocumented especially in rural areas since most incidences of snakebite are attended by traditional healers/herbalists mainly by using plants.
